Entergy Mississippi January winter storm update – 2/3/2026, 10 a.m.

Entergy Mississippi crews continue to make steady progress, restoring service to about 84,600 customers, which is about 97% of the approximately 87,000 customers who lost service since the storm began affecting our service areas.

Behind the scenes of the restoration: Battling the winter weather

As Darren Cox held his newborn child in his arms for the first time, he didn’t anticipate that less than a month later, he’d be leaving his home for days on end—working through snow, ice and freezing temperatures to restore power to our customers across our region. For Entergy Mississippi lineworkers like Darren, this is what service looks like when severe weather strikes.

Entergy Louisiana restores power to majority of customers impacted by winter storm

Entergy Louisiana crews have restored power to 90% of customers impacted at the peak of the recent winter storm, marking a major milestone in a challenging and complex restoration effort across north Louisiana.
